The Enterprise, White Salmon, WA., August 11, 1955, page 1

T. HOODENPYL PASSES IN HOOD RIVER HOSPITAL

     Funeral services will be held Friday at Gardners Funeral Home here for Thomas M. Hoodenpyl, who passed away at the Hood River Community Hospital on August 9.
     Born at Gaston, Oregon on September 1, 1907, Thomas Hoodenpyl had been a resident of Glenwood for 9 years. He is survived by his wife Laura, a son Steve, a daughter Judy. Also his mother, Mrs. Winnie Hoodenpyl of Gaston; 3 brothers, E.P. Hoodenpyl and William, both of Gaston and Herbert of Forest Grove, Oregon. One sister Mrs. O.K. Myers of Bend, Oregon.
     He was a member of the Mt. Adams Elks, BPOE 1868. Services will be conducted by the lodge Friday at 10 a.m. at Gardner's. Interment will be at Forest Grove View Cemetery at Forest Grove, at 2 p.m.
     He attended school at Scroggins Valley near Gaston.
     Before coming to Glenwood in 1949 he resided in Carlton, Oregon, where he was united in marriage to Laura Garrison on May 17, 1930 at Forest Grove, Oregon.


The Mt. Adams Sun, Bingen, WA., August 11, 1955, page 10

RITES FRIDAY FOR THOMAS HOODENPYL

     Glenwood (special) Services will be held at 10 a.m. Friday August 12, at Gardners funeral home in White Salmon for Thomas M. Hoodenpyl, 47, resident of Glenwood since 1946. Mt. Adams Elks Lodge 1868 will officiate.
     Pall bearers will be Ollie Kreps, Homer Babcock, Wilbur Yaekel, George Lyle, Merle Akerill and Gene Karl.
     Burial will be at Forest View cemetery, Forest Grove, at 2 p.m., with the Rev. Morrison of Gaston's Congregational church in charge.
     Mr. Hoodenpyl was born September 1, 1907 at Gaston, Oregon where he attended Scroggins Valley school. On May 17, 1930, he was married to Laura Garrison at Forest Grove. He died in Hood River hospital, Tuesday, August 9, of leukemia.
     Survivors include his wife, Laura; son Steve; and daughter, Judy, all of Glenwood; his mother, Mrs. Winnie Hoodenpyl of Gaston; brothers, E.P. and William Hoodenpyl, also of Gaston, and Herbert of Forest Grove; and sister Mrs. O.K. Myers of Bend, Oregon.
